What is Happening
2026 marks the official start of the Tax Reform transition in Brazil. Starting in January, the so-called "operational testing phase" began — with real financial transactions, but at symbolic percentages.
The main change is the introduction of the Dual VAT: a combined rate of 1% on goods and services, split between CBS (federal, 0.9%) and IBS (state/municipal, 0.1%).
Will it Get More Expensive?
No, at least not right now. The 1% rate in this first year is offset by reductions in other taxes. The goal is to test the mechanics of the system without increasing the overall tax burden.
The complete transition will last until 2033. Each year, the VAT will gradually increase while the old taxes (ICMS, ISS, PIS, Cofins, IPI) decrease.
What Changes in Practice
In day-to-day life, in 2026 you will notice little difference. But it’s worth paying attention to a few points:
- Invoices: will start to show the breakdown of CBS and IBS, even if in small amounts
- Cashback for low income: the reform provides for tax refunds for lower-income families, but the regulations are still being defined
- Services: sectors such as health, education, and public transport will have reduced rates or exemptions
- Basic food basket: essential foods will have a zero rate
How to Prepare
The reform does not require immediate action from consumers, but it is a good time to:
- Organize your budget: knowing exactly how much you spend in each category helps identify any future impact
- Follow the transition: business owners and freelancers should prepare for changes in the tax regime
- Review investments: the reform may affect specific sectors — real estate, retail, services. Diversifying is always wise.
The most important thing: have clarity about your financial situation. Those who organize their money by purpose are better prepared for any change.
